Pay starts at $16.00/hour. School year only. Morning afternoon or both shifts are available.
Bus Aide
Qualifications: 1. High School Diploma or equivalent
2. Willingness and ability to assist handicapped students board and depart the bus
Reports to: Supervisor of Transportation
Job Status: Parttime nonexempt position
Job Goal: Assisting special education students while they are being transported to and from school; and providing a consistent environment discipline and guidance for the students while
they are on the bus.

Job Requirements: Minimum Qualifications
Skills Knowledge and Abilities
SKILLS are required to perform multiple nontechnical tasks using existing skills. Specific skills required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: adhering to safety practices; and utilizing restraints and assistive equipment.
KNOWLEDGE is required to understand written procedures write routine documents and speak clearly; and understand complex multistep written and oral instructions. Specific knowledge required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job includes: safety practices and procedures; and approved procedures/techniques involved in supervising students.
ABILITY is required to use jobrelated equipment. Flexibility is required to work with others in a wide variety of circumstances; and operate equipment using standardized methods. Problem solving with data requires following prescribed guidelines; and problem solving with equipment is moderate. Specific abilities required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: maintaining confidentiality; being flexible; communicating with children with diverse disabilities; developing relationships with students; and demonstrating and/or modeling appropriate behavior.
Responsibilities include: working under limited supervision following standardized practices and/or methods; providing information and/or advising others; and operating within a defined budget. There is a continual opportunity to impact the Organizations services.
Responsibility
The usual and customary methods of performing the jobs functions require the following physical demands: significant lifting carrying pushing and/or pulling; significant climbing and balancing; some stooping kneeling crouching and/or crawling; and significant fine finger dexterity. Generally the job requires 70% sitting 15% walking and 15% standing.
Working Environment
The job is performed under minimal temperature variations and some hazardous conditions.
